Bradley Cooper Channels His Inner Gordon Ramsey in Burnt

Get a first look at Bradley Cooper in “Burnt” where he plays a rock star chef with a second chance to open a major European restaurant.

Bradley Cooper is back on the big screen with the first trailer for his new film Burnt being released this Thursday.

In Burnt, which was previously titled Adam Jones, Cooper plays a washed up former chef who decides to make a comeback. And with that, we see all of the drama that comes with running a top-notch restaurant. That includes screaming at employees,

plate smashing, and getting targeted by local gangsters for trying to open a new restaurant in Europe. 

In 2005, Cooper starred in the short-lived Kitchen Confidential (based on Anthony Bourdain’s book of the same name) as Jack Bourdain, a hard-living, drug-addicted rock star young chef given the chance to take over a major Manhattan restaurant and stage a career comeback.

So here we are now, in 2015, and Cooper is playing Adam Jones, a hard-living, drug-addicted rock star young chef given the chance to take over a major London restaurant and stage a career comeback. Kapow! Burnt is a had-it-all lost-it-all story with some intense moments and plenty of food porn.

Uma Thurman, Omar Sy, and Emma Thompson also star in the film, which is set to release on October 23rd. Have a look and let us know what you think.
